S. Mogesh & M. Elancheleyen Awarded Prestigious Yang di-Pertuan Agong Scholarship;Inspiring Gen Z

Two young lads are paving their ways in the educational field

Two empowering Malaysian students have placed our Indian community on the nation’s academic map. 

According to the Istana Negara Facebook page, the Yang di-Pertuan Agong Al-Sultan Abdullah Ri’ayatuddin Al-Mustafa Billah Shah conferred the prestigious Scholarship for the 2021 session to 10 recipients at the Istana Negara here.

BYDPA offers 12 scholarships, six each at the master’s level and PhD level to study in the fields of Science and Technology, Economics, Law and Islamic Finance. 

Mogesh Sababathy who has completed his Marine Biology degree with excellence at University Malaysia Terengganu (UMT) has also received a scholarship to pursue his Doctorate (PhD) level under Clinical and Health Sciences (Stem Cells). 

Previously, the Commonwealth Youth Award 2021 finalist who has managed his success whilst being the recipient of the Royal Education Award from Universiti Malaysia Terengganu (UMT) has also been seen alongside Elancheleyen at the prestigious session.

Also known as the co-founder of ‘Project Ocean Hope’, the 24-year-old young lad through campaigns and youth leadership training has raised awareness of ocean issues and environmental conservation.

Image Credit: Istana Negara Facebook Page

To fill you in, the application for the Yang di-Pertuan Agong 2021 scholarship (BYDPA) for local as well as overseas Master’s and Doctorate (PhD) programmes began last April. 

Established in 2016, to date a total number of 175 individuals have received the prestigious scholarship to pursue their studies at local research universities as well as the world’s leading universities in the fields of Science and Technology, Economics, Law and Islamic Finance.

In addition, Elancheleyen will be pursuing a Master’s degree programme in Tissue Engineering at the University Kebangsaan Malaysia (UKM). It was truly an amazing honour for the 24-year-old who has a strong passion in the field. 

Our heartfelt congratulations to all the recipients!
